PURPOSE:To recover valuables contained in coal in a simple manner with a high purity and a high yield, by feeding coal into molten iron to decompose and release hydrogen contained in the coal, dissolving carbon contained in the coal in the molten iron, depositing the carbon, and suspending ash on the molten iron. CONSTITUTION:Molten iron 2 of 1,535 deg.C or above is fed into a heat resistant, rectangular parallelepiped, hermetically sealed coal decomposition container 1 and is circulated upward and downward. A CO gas is blown into the container from a blowing pipe 4 to promote the circulation of the molten iron 2, while pulverized coal is carried on the CO gas stream and is fed from a blowing pipe 3 into the container. The pulverized coal which is carried on the ascending stream 6 is decomposed by high temp. molten iron, thereby causing phenomena such as formation of a hydrogen-contg. gas, formation of molten slag which is ash and dissolution of carbon into the molten iron 2. The hydrogen-contg. gas is discharged through a discharging passage 9, while the molten slag 7 is discharged outside the system through a discharging passage 8 after it is suspended on the upper layer. When the temp. of the molten iron is 1,153 deg.C or above and the concentration of the carbon is 4.25% or more, part of the carbon which is in a dissolved state is deposited accompanying the dropping of the temp. in the ascending of the pulverized coal and is discharged outside the system through the passages 8, 9. |
